What Sand Do You Use For Laying Artificial Grass. Artificial grass infill protects the grass from dog claws, sharp objects, vandalism, play equipment and garden furniture feet. It provides improved durability, better moisture. A base layer of crushed rock or sand is then laid and compacted to create a smooth. Artificial grass is installed by first preparing the area, which involves removing existing grass and debris. Sand infill keeps your artificial grass lawn cool in the summer and prevents the expansion of the grass in the hottest months. It differs from normal sharp /regular sand in that it is at least 95% silicon dioxide. The most common type of sand used as infill for artificial grass is silica sand.
